Detailed Engineering Specifications

Built to exacting engineering tolerances, this 0.884" thick sheet boasts a nominal composition of 18% chromium and 8% nickel, providing superior resistance to a wide range of corrosive environments. The 45" x 46" dimensions offer a substantial surface area suitable for fabricating custom trays, chutes, covers, and structural components within material handling systems. This grade exhibits excellent formability and weldability, allowing for efficient fabrication and customization to meet specific operational demands in food processing, chemical handling, and general industrial settings.

Mechanical Properties

Tensile Strength75,000 psi (515 MPa)
Yield Strength30,000 psi (205 MPa)
Elongation in 2 in.40% min
HardnessRockwell B95 max

Chemical Composition

Carbon (C)0.08% max
Chromium (Cr)18.0 - 20.0%
Nickel (Ni)8.0 - 10.5%
Manganese (Mn)2.00% max

Common Mistakes & How to Avoid Them

❌ Mistake✅ Correct Approach
Attempting to cut with standard carbon steel tools, leading to contamination and reduced corrosion resistance.Use dedicated stainless steel cutting tools and maintain strict separation from carbon steel materials.
Improper welding procedures that can lead to sensitization and intergranular corrosion.Employ appropriate welding techniques for 304 stainless steel, such as TIG or MIG welding, and consider post-weld heat treatment if necessary.
